Benefits of Running Machines

Running machines use myriad advantages for individuals of all fitness levels. Whether one is an experienced runner or a novice, treadmills offer different benefits, that include:

  • Convenience:
    Treadmills allow for indoor running, untouched by climate condition or time of day. This convenience means that users can stick to their physical fitness regimens year-round.

  • Adjustable Workouts:
    Most modern running machines come geared up with features that allow users to change speed, slope, and set exercises, enabling customized fitness experiences.

  • Injury Prevention:
    Compared to outdoor running, treadmills frequently feature cushioned surfaces, which can minimize the influence on joints and lower the threat of injuries.

  • Tracking Progress:
    Many running machines have built-in monitors that track range, speed, calories burned, and heart rate, offering users with valuable feedback on their development.

  • Multi-Functional Use:
    Many treadmills have the ability for walking, running, and running, making them versatile machines suitable for all fitness levels.

Kinds Of Running Machines

When considering a running machine, it’s necessary to understand the various types readily available on the market. Below is a list of the most typical types:

  1. Manual Treadmills:
    These treadmills don’t have a motor and count on the user’s initiative to create the motion. They are frequently more economical but require more effort to utilize.

  2. Motorized Treadmills:
    Motorized treadmills are the most popular choice and come with various functions, consisting of multiple speed settings and programmable workouts.

  3. Collapsible Treadmills:
    Ideal for small living spaces, these machines can be folded up for storage when not in use. They usually feature fewer bells and whistles due to their compact nature.

  4. Business Treadmills:
    Commonly used in gyms and gym, these treadmills are constructed for heavy use and typically featured innovative functions and greater weight limits.

  5. Smart Treadmills:
    Equipped with connectivity features, wise treadmills can sync with fitness apps and sites, supplying users real-time information and personalized exercise plans.

Buying a Running Machine in the UK

When picking a running machine, it’s vital to keep various factors in mind to ensure that the ideal choice is made. Below is a checklist of factors to consider:

  • Budget:
    Determine just how much you want to spend. Treadmills can differ considerably in rate, from budget plan models to high-end commercial machines.

  • Space Availability:
    Measure the area where you plan to put the treadmill to ensure it fits comfortably, and consider foldable designs if space is limited.

  • Functions:
    Look for features that match your exercise design, such as adjustable slopes, built-in exercise programs, heart rate displays, and Bluetooth connectivity.

  • Warranty and Support:
    Opt for manufacturers that offer warranties and reputable client support. A great warranty can protect your investment.

  • User Reviews:
    Reading consumer evaluations can provide insights into the performance and reliability of various models.

Table 1: Comparison of Treadmill Types

Treadmill Type Rate Range Functions Best For
Manual Treadmills ₤ 100 – ₤ 400 Standard style, no motor Budget-conscious users
Motorized Treadmills ₤ 300 – ₤ 2000 Adjustable speed, incline, different programs Regular runners
Foldable Treadmills ₤ 150 – ₤ 800 compact treadmill design Restricted area
Commercial Treadmills ₤ 800 – ₤ 5000 High sturdiness, advanced functions Heavy gym usage
Smart Treadmills ₤ 600 – ₤ 3000 Connection, virtual workouts Tech-savvy users

Upkeep of Running Machines

Using a running machine is just one part of the formula; keeping it is similarly important for longevity and performance. Below are necessary upkeep tips:

  • Regular Cleaning:
    Dust and sweat can build up on the machine. Routinely wipe down surfaces to prevent buildup.

  • Lubrication:
    Ensure that the treadmill small belt is properly lubricated to lessen friction and wear. Seek advice from the producer’s recommendations for maintenance schedules.

  • Check the Belt Alignment:
    Occasionally, the running belt may need positioning. This can normally be changed with the offered tools and instructions.

  • Check Wiring and Components:
    Periodically check for any indications of wear in electrical elements. If something seems wrong, speak with an expert technician.

  • Follow the User Manual:
    Keep the user handbook useful and follow any specific suggestions for maintenance and care.
